Output 3ab84da2bac8a2eb91ac3f360ebcd995a54d05faa062ae45f0c6714ea565c577:1

value
1017009295
script pubkey
OP_0 OP_PUSHBYTES_20 685440f8343233b1194acea565dde5fbdfd58b04
address
bc1qdp2yp7p5xgemzx22e6jkth09l00atzcyq4ywyl
transaction
3ab84da2bac8a2eb91ac3f360ebcd995a54d05faa062ae45f0c6714ea565c577
confirmations
228215
spent
true